LTC insurance claims are hard to get approved because so many claims are not actually long term care.
When a claim is declined, the family becomes disgruntled and angry at the insurance company.
Usually the problem is what the providers/doctors, facilities are reporting when filing the claim.
LTC News reported over $15 billion was paid in claims in 2024. See the details at https://www.ltcnews.com/articles/rising-claims-growing-demand-long-term-care-insurance-key-retirement-plan
AHIP (America's Health Insurance Plans) reports over $16 billion paid in 2024 and separates results by states at https://www.ahip.org/resources/long-term-care-insurance-coverage-state-to-state-2025
